A Tender Tale Unfolds: 'The Fragrant Flower Blooms With Dignity' Premieres July 6

Beloved by manga enthusiasts, The Fragrant Flower Blooms With Dignity by Saka Mikami has captured the hearts of fans with its gentle and sincere storytelling. Serialized on the official Weekly Shonen Magazine app, Magazine Pocket, the manga has distinguished itself in the shonen genre, selling over five million copies as of June 2025.

Anticipation for the series has reached new heights, with the official X account gaining 80,000 followers even before the first episode's premiere, and the trailer amassing over 2.4 million views. We are thrilled to unveil a second stunning piece of key art and a new trailer, along with the announcement that Tatsuya Kitani will perform the opening theme song, while Reira Ushio sings the ending theme.

The newly released key art beautifully captures a tender moment between Rintaro Tsumugi and Kaoruko Waguri, as they gaze into each other's eyes while walking side by side. What unique worlds will they inhabit, and what will their journey look like?

The trailer offers the first-ever glimpse of scenes from the anime, brought to life with the opening theme "Manazashi wa Hikari" by Tatsuya Kitani and the ending theme "Hare no Hi ni" by Reira Ushio. Together, these elements set the stage for a vibrant coming-of-age story set to grace your screens this summer.

The Fragrant Flower Blooms With Dignity streams starting July 6 on Netflix.

About The Fragrant Flower Blooms With Dignity

STORY

This story unfolds in a particular town where two infamous schools are in constant dispute: Chidori High, a boys' school primarily attended by students with challenging academic records, and its neighbor, Kikyo Girls' High, known for its students hailing from wealthy and prestigious families.

One day, Rintaro Tsumugi, a second-year student at Chidori with a fierce appearance but a gentle heart, is assisting at his family's patisserie when he meets a customer named Kaoruko Waguri. Rintaro cherishes his interactions with Kaoruko, as she doesn't judge him based on his looks. However, this serene connection is abruptly shaken when Rintaro discovers that Kaoruko is actually a student at Kikyo. This revelation sets the stage for their challenging journey, as they strive to overcome the societal barriers imposed by their schools and environment, seeking to carve out their own path.

STAFF
Original Work: "The Fragrant Flower Blooms With Dignity" by Saka Mikami (Serialized on Magazine Pocket from Kodansha)
Director: Miyuki Kuroki
Associate Director: Satoshi Yamaguchi
Series Composition: Rino Yamazaki
Series Director: Haruka Tsuzuki
Character Design and Chief Animation Supervisor: Kohei Tokuoka
Minor Character and Clothing Design: Manami Umeshita
Cake Design: Yasuho Tamura
Prop Design: Yuko Yoshida
Art Director: Asuka Koki
Art Setting: Yoshinori Shiozawa
Color Design: Asuka Yokota
Cinematographer: Yukiko Nagase
3D Director: Keita Watanabe (Sublimation)
Editing: Kazuhiro Nii
Music: Moeki Harada
Sound Director: Takatoshi Hamano
Sound Production: Magic Capsule
Production: CloverWorks

Theme Song
Opening: Manazashi wa Hikari by Tatsuya Kitani
Ending: Hare no Hi ni by Reira Ushio
